Creating a Culture of Success Through Teamwork in Schools
On May 22, 2007, NCTAF, MetLife Foundation, and WTIU held a town hall meeting on, "Creating a Culture of Success Through Teamwork in Schools." Participants saw learning teams in action in a WTIU-produced 6-minute video spotlight on Columbus East High School, followed by a town hall meeting on why teamwork is integral to improved teaching quality and student achievement.
